About the Project

The project aimed to equip the Oeste Intermunicipal Community (CIM Oeste) with its first integrated territorial intelligence platform, leveraging big data and data science. This platform provided the ability to collect, store, process, and analyze data from operational systems and municipal sensor networks, combined with data generated by public Wi-Fi networks across the municipalities. Doing so transformed the paradigm of tourism planning and management, adopting a Smart & Sustainable Tourism approach.

One of the project’s key innovations was its focus on understanding how people interact with the CIM Oeste region, using Wi-Fi access point data to analyze movements in both space and time. By merging this information with municipal operational systems, the project developed a dynamic, real-time application that enhanced the experience for residents, workers, and visitors. This integration of diverse data streams allowed for smarter, context-driven marketing actions and improved decision-making for tourism management.

 

Funding

  • Funding Programme: AMA - Agency for Administrative Modernisation I.P.
  • Funding to NOVA IMS: 999.843,00€
  • Duration: 2020 - 2023

Our contribution

NOVA IMS was the coordinator of this project that led to the development of this territorial analytical platform designed to change the paradigm of how local authorities manage public policies, using data-driven decision-making.

Since the project's completion, the Smart Region team has expanded its model to collaborate with other inter-municipal communities, even preparing to bring the Smart Region concept to Brazil through a cooperation agreement. Additionally, NOVA Cidade – Urban Analytics Lab, the project's key partner, received the prestigious ESRI SAG Award, which will be presented at the upcoming ESRI Annual World Conference, recognizing the project’s outstanding contributions to geographic information systems (GIS) and urban analytics.

This project has set a benchmark for leveraging data-driven regional planning insights, significantly advancing smart tourism research and sustainable urban development.
